    Nothing turned up in a search about this, so sorry if this has come up, please show me link if its discussed...

    For offroading in my 07 Sport Ed I rarely wore my seatbelt (beach, slow rolling, frequent in and out for photography and fishing) and there was never an audible seatbelt chime. The 07 retired last month...

    I just got an 08 SR5, and noticed while driving off-road that the seatbelt chime does not shut off until I insert the belt. Is there an easy way to disable this? I suppose I could just sit with the belt inserted and behind me, but would rather disable it. On-road or on unfamiliar terrain I always wear the belt and don't need a chime to remind me, but this is a PIA for offroad usage.
